About

Rex A. Hess is a scholar working on Reproductive Medicine, Genetics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Rex A. Hess has authored 228 papers receiving a total of 14.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 132 papers in Reproductive Medicine, 96 papers in Genetics and 76 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Rex A. Hess’s work include Sperm and Testicular Function (120 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(55 papers) and Genetic and Clinical Aspects of Sex Determination and Chromosomal Abnormalities (38 papers). Rex A. Hess is often cited by papers focused on Sperm and Testicular Function (120 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(55 papers) and Genetic and Clinical Aspects of Sex Determination and Chromosomal Abnormalities (38 papers). Rex A. Hess collaborates with scholars based in United States, Brazil and China. Rex A. Hess's co-authors include David Bunick, Paul S. Cooke, Luiz R. França, Janice M. Bahr, Dennis B. Lubahn, Qing Zhou, Marie‐Claude Hofmann, Rong Nie, Gail S. Prins and Kay Carnes and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Nucleic Acids Research.
